What Our Gearhead® Experts Are Saying:
"The Kubo hits a sweet spot for climbers who want something comfortable enough for long sessions but still capable on technical terrain. The LaspoFlex midsole gives it enough structure for edging without killing sensitivity, and the Vibram XS Edge outsole smears well on both rock and plastic. One durability note worth mentioning: a small number of climbers have reported toe rand separation with heavy use, so if you're climbing high volume, keep an eye on that area and consider resoling before it becomes a bigger issue."
Who It's For
Intermediate climbers wanting an all-day shoe for routes, multi-pitch, and gym sessions
The Kubo is built for climbers who are past the beginner stage and want a shoe that performs across a range of terrain without demanding an aggressive, painful fit. It's a strong match for sport climbers doing longer routes, gym climbers who log a lot of time on the wall, and multi-pitch climbers who need to wear their shoes through extended pitches and belay stances. Climbers chasing performance bouldering or projecting hard single moves will likely want something more aggressive.
What It's For
Sport climbing, gym climbing, and moderate multi-pitch routes
The Kubo is at home on vertical to slightly overhung terrain where smearing, edging, and crack climbing all come up in the same session. The unlined interior and padded tongue make extended wear tolerable, and the moderate profile keeps it versatile enough for gym climbing, outdoor sport routes, and multi-pitch days where comfort over time matters as much as raw performance at any single moment.
Why We Like It
Capable Vibram rubber, a comfortable unlined fit, and enough structure for technical terrain
The 4mm Vibram XS Edge outsole is the headline — it's a rubber compound that performs on both rock and plastic, generating friction on smears and holding precise edge placements without feeling mushy. The 1.1mm full-length LaspoFlex midsole adds just enough structure to support edging without turning the shoe stiff, which helps on longer routes where foot fatigue adds up. The unlined interior lets the microfiber and leather upper conform to your foot shape over time, and the toe rand uses the same Vibram XS Edge compound for consistent grip and bite when heel hooking or jamming in cracks. Dual hook-and-loop closure keeps on-off fast at the base of pitches.
